The Role of an Automotive Car Locksmith
An automotive car locksmith is a customized professional trained to deal with all lock-related problems for lorries. They are equipped with the understanding and tools to attend to a range of issues, from lost or broken keys to malfunctioning ignitions and harmed locks. Here's a brief summary of what these experts can do:
Key Replacement and Duplication
- Lost or stolen keys can be a considerable inconvenience and security risk. A competent locksmith can develop duplicate keys for your vehicle, ensuring you have a backup in case of emergencies.
- They can likewise replace lost keys, which typically involves programming brand-new keys for contemporary vehicles with integrated security systems.
Lock and Ignition Repair
- In time, car locks and ignitions can use out due to regular use or direct exposure to extreme weather. A locksmith can diagnose and repair these problems, restoring the performance of your vehicle's locks and preventing additional damage.
Key Fob Programming
- Modern cars include advanced key fobs that control different functions, consisting of locking, opening, and beginning the vehicle. If your key fob quits working, a locksmith can reprogram it, ensuring it works as intended.
Transponder Key Services
- Transponder keys are a security function in numerous modern-day cars. These keys have an ingrained chip that interacts with the car's computer system to permit it to begin. A locksmith can program and replace these keys, preserving the security of your vehicle.
Trunk and Glove Box Unlocking
- Accidentally locking your keys in the trunk or glove box can be as aggravating as being locked out of your car. A locksmith can securely and effectively unlock these compartments without triggering damage to your vehicle.
High-Security Lock Installation
- For those seeking enhanced security, a locksmith can set up high-security locks on your vehicle, making it more resistant to theft and unapproved access.

FAQ: Common Questions About Automotive Car Locksmiths
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?
- A: The very first action is to stay calm. Check if you have a spare key saved in a safe location. If not, call a professional locksmith who can create a replicate key or help you enter your vehicle without causing damage. Avoid using DIY approaches, as they can typically lead to more considerable problems.
Q: How long does it require to get a new key made?
- A: The time it takes to make a brand-new key can differ depending on the type of key and the intricacy of the vehicle's lock system. Simple key duplications can take just a couple of minutes, while programming a transponder key may take longer, generally 30 minutes to an hour.
Q: Can a locksmith help if I lock my keys in the car?
- A: Yes, an expert locksmith can assist you unlock your car without causing damage. They use specialized tools and methods to open the locks and retrieve your keys.
Q: Are locksmiths more costly than dealers?
- A: Not necessarily. While dealerships may charge more due to the higher overhead expenses, professional locksmith professionals typically offer more economical rates for key duplication and programming services. In addition, locksmith professionals can conserve you time by supplying on-site services, whereas you may need to check out a car dealership.
Q: Is it legal to have a locksmith make a replicate key without the initial?
- A: The legality of making a replicate key without the original can vary by place. In many places, locksmith professionals are needed to verify ownership or have a signed authorization before producing a new key. Constantly make sure the locksmith you work with follows local regulations and laws.
